altos: Shuffle LCO functions around, add telelco first cut
[fw/altos] / altoslib / AltosTelemetryIterable.java
index f4b4029f176eabb8aa16ce0537cbb3a8c115ff17..e95c15e0b5026438a8f856ff3ff18b5d0cffd596 100644 (file)
@@ -45,7 +45,7 @@ public class AltosTelemetryIterable extends AltosRecordIterable {
 
                try {
                        for (;;) {
-                               String line = AltosRecord.gets(input);
+                               String line = AltosLib.gets(input);
                                if (line == null) {
                                        break;
                                }
@@ -67,11 +67,11 @@ public class AltosTelemetryIterable extends AltosRecordIterable {
                                                saw_boost = true;
                                                boost_tick = record.tick;
                                        }
-                                       if (record.accel != AltosRecord.MISSING)
+                                       if (record.acceleration() != AltosRecord.MISSING)
                                                has_accel = true;
                                        if (record.gps != null)
                                                has_gps = true;
-                                       if (record.main != AltosRecord.MISSING)
+                                       if (record.main_voltage() != AltosRecord.MISSING)
                                                has_ignite = true;
                                        if (previous != null && previous.tick != record.tick)
                                                records.add(previous);